PHILADELPHIA (WPVI) -- Pennsylvania State Police have arrested a man they say hit and killed a man with his car, and then attempted to destroy the evidence.

Police say 29-year-old Julius Crabbe was involved in a deadly hit-and-run on July 22nd on the Schuylkill Expressway in Philadelphia's Fairmount Park.

They say Crabbe fled the scene and conspired with the owner of the vehicle he was driving to set it on fire to destroy evidence.

The vehicle's owner then allegedly filed a stolen vehicle report.

Crabbe faces several charges, including involuntary manslaughter.
